Responsibilities

  • Create and maintain reports that benchmark sales performance, identifying strengths and areas for improvement.
  • Assess and analyze pipeline generation efforts, providing insights into lead conversion rates, pipeline health, and sales cycle trends.
  • Build and refine a suite of standardized reports and dashboards to ensure visibility into key sales metrics.
  • Transition existing performance and forecast reports from spreadsheets into automated, scalable reporting solutions.
  • Work with sales leadership to enhance forecasting models, incorporating historical data and predictive analytics.
  • Conduct deep-dive analyses to identify trends, risks, and opportunities that inform sales strategies and business decisions.
  • Define the strategic approach for report tooling and implement scalable BI solutions to support sales analytics.


Qualifications



  • Minimum of 5+ years in a GTM Operations or Finance role
  • Proficiency in PowerBI or similar BI solutions to develop and manage reporting frameworks.
  • Advanced experience with Salesforce, including creating reports, dashboards, and data visualization.
  • Strong understanding of sales metrics including weighted pipeline, pipeline velocity, win rates, linearity, and other performance indicators.
  • Experience leading reporting initiatives with a structured change management process to ensure adoption and consistency.
  • Strong philosophy of report management, including tool selection, organization, and standardization to maintain consistency and accuracy.
  • Knowledge of sales enablement tools like Clari, Outreach, Gong, or similar platforms.
  • Experience leveraging advanced predictive analytics techniques to improve revenue forecasting, pipeline health assessment, and risk mitigation.
  • Ability to query and manipulate large datasets for deeper analysis.
  • Expertise in presenting data-driven insights through compelling visualizations.
